Key Industrial Clusters: Air Purifier Manufacturing in China
China’s air purifier manufacturing is concentrated in three primary clusters, each with distinct competitive advantages:
| Cluster | Core Cities | Specialization | Key Strengths |
|---|---|---|---|
| Guangdong | Shenzhen, Guangzhou, Dongguan | High-tech, smart/IoT-enabled purifiers; Medical-grade units; Export-focused OEMs | Deepest component ecosystem (sensors, PCBs, motors); Strongest R&D Best compliance support for EU/US markets |
| Zhejiang | Ningbo, Hangzhou, Yuyao | Mid-range consumer purifiers; HEPA/carbon filter systems; Cost-optimized OEMs | Highest concentration of filter media suppliers; Competitive labor costs; Agile small-batch production |
| Jiangsu | Suzhou, Wuxi, Nanjing | Industrial/commercial purifiers; CADR-focused units; Hybrid HVAC systems | Precision engineering expertise; Strong industrial client base; Advanced material science R&D |
Note: Shanghai (Pudong) hosts HQs of major players (e.g., Philips China, Honeywell) but relies on satellite factories in Jiangsu/Zhejiang for assembly. Anhui (Hefei) is an emerging cluster for budget units but lacks export compliance maturity.

2. Key Technical Specifications
2.1 Core Components & Materials
| Component | Material Specification | Purpose |
|---|---|---|
| Housing | ABS or PP (UL94 V-0 Flame Rated) | Impact resistance, flame retardancy |
| Pre-Filter | Washable polypropylene mesh | Captures large particles (dust, hair) |
| HEPA Filter | H13 or H14 grade (EN 1822) | Removes 99.95% of particles ≥0.3 µm |
| Activated Carbon Filter | Coconut shell-based carbon (≥800 mg/g iodine adsorption) | Adsorbs VOCs, odors |
| Fan Motor | Brushless DC (BLDC), IP54 rated | Energy-efficient, low noise (<30 dB at low speed) |
| Sensor Module | Laser PM2.5 sensor (e.g., Plantower PMS5003) | Real-time air quality monitoring |
| Control PCB | FR-4 substrate, conformal coating | EMI resistance, moisture protection |
2.2 Dimensional & Performance Tolerances
| Parameter | Standard Tolerance | Acceptance Threshold |
|---|---|---|
| Airflow (CADR) | ±5% of rated value | Must meet declared Clean Air Delivery Rate (e.g., 300 m³/h) |
| Noise Level | ±2 dB(A) | Max 65 dB at high speed; ≤30 dB at sleep mode |
| Power Consumption | ±10% of rated | Verified under IEC 62841-1 |
| Filter Fitment | ±0.5 mm gap tolerance | Ensures zero air bypass around filters |
| Housing Dimension | ±0.3 mm (injection molded parts) | Critical for assembly and sealing |
3. Essential Compliance & Certifications
Procurement managers must verify that Chinese manufacturers hold the following certifications for market access and quality assurance:
| Certification | Governing Body | Scope | Requirement for Market |
|---|---|---|---|
| CE (EMC + LVD) | EU Notified Body | Electromagnetic compatibility, electrical safety | Mandatory for EU |
| UL 867 / UL 2998 | Underwriters Laboratories | Electrostatic precipitators / Zero Ozone Emissions | Required for US commercial sales |
| FDA Registration | U.S. Food & Drug Administration | Devices making medical claims (e.g., allergen reduction) | Required if marketed as medical-grade |
| ISO 9001:2015 | International Organization for Standardization | Quality Management System | Indicator of process consistency |
| RoHS & REACH | EU Regulations | Restriction of hazardous substances | Mandatory in EU; increasingly requested globally |
| China CCC | CNCA (China Compulsory Certification) | Electrical safety for domestic market | Required for products sold in China |
Note: For North America, UL or ETL listing via a Nationally Recognized Testing Laboratory (NRTL) is strongly advised. For medical claims, FDA 510(k) may apply.
4. Common Quality Defects and Prevention Strategies
| Common Quality Defect | Description | Root Cause | Prevention Strategy |
|---|---|---|---|
| Filter Bypass | Air leaks around filter housing, reducing efficiency | Poor housing tolerance or misaligned filter slots | Implement SPC (Statistical Process Control) on injection molding; conduct airflow seal testing pre-shipment |
| Excessive Noise | Fan generates >65 dB(A) at high speed | Imbalanced impeller or loose motor mount | Perform dynamic balancing of BLDC fans; torque-spec motor screws |
| Ozone Emission | >50 ppb ozone from ionizers or plasma modules | Poor high-voltage circuit design | Use UL 2998-certified ionization modules; test with ozone analyzer |
| Sensor Inaccuracy | PM2.5 readings deviate >15% from reference | Contaminated laser chamber or calibration drift | Calibrate sensors in controlled test chambers; apply protective mesh |
| PCB Failure | Corrosion or short circuits in humid environments | Lack of conformal coating or poor sealing | Apply ISO-compliant acrylic conformal coating; use IP-rated enclosures |
| Housing Warpage | Distorted casing due to uneven cooling | Inadequate mold temperature control | Optimize cooling cycle; monitor mold temp with IoT sensors |
| Weak HEPA Integrity | Filter media torn or poorly sealed | Low-grade media or automated sealing errors | Source HEPA from certified suppliers (e.g., 3M, Camfil); conduct burst pressure tests |

White Label vs. Private Label: Strategic Comparison
Critical Differentiators for Brand Ownership & Margin Control
| Factor | White Label | Private Label | Procurement Impact |
|---|---|---|---|
| Definition | Pre-existing design; only logo/branding changed | Fully customized design, engineering, & features | White label = faster time-to-market; Private label = brand differentiation |
| MOQ Flexibility | Low (500–1,000 units) | High (1,000–5,000+ units) | White label suits test launches; Private label requires volume commitment |
| Tooling Costs | $0 (uses supplier’s existing molds) | $8,000–$25,000 (new molds/certifications) | Private label adds 6–8 weeks lead time & upfront CAPEX |
| Compliance Control | Supplier-managed (risk: generic standards) | Brand-managed (full regulatory oversight) | Critical for EU Ecodesign/US EPA compliance; reduces recall risk |
| Margin Potential | 25–35% (commoditized pricing) | 40–60% (premium positioning) | Private label justifies higher retail pricing |
| Best For | New market entrants; budget constraints | Established brands; premium positioning | Recommendation: Start white label → transition to private label at 5K+ units |
Strategic Insight: 68% of 2025 SourcifyChina clients adopted a hybrid approach—launching with white label to validate demand, then migrating to private label at MOQ 5K to capture margin upside. Always audit supplier compliance documentation (ISO 16890, CARB, CE) pre-production.

Critical Steps to Verify Air Purifier Manufacturers in China
Sourcing high-quality air purifiers from China requires a structured due diligence process to ensure product reliability, compliance, and long-term supply chain stability. This report outlines the essential verification steps, differentiates between trading companies and actual factories, and highlights key red flags to avoid.
1. Step-by-Step Verification Process for Air Purifier Manufacturers
| Step | Action | Purpose | Verification Method |
|---|---|---|---|
| 1.1 | Initial Supplier Screening | Identify potential suppliers via B2B platforms (e.g., Alibaba, Made-in-China), industry trade shows (e.g., Canton Fair), or referrals. | Cross-reference supplier profiles with industry databases (e.g., Panjiva, ImportGenius). |
| 1.2 | Request Business License & MOQ Data | Confirm legal operation and production capacity. | Ask for a copy of the Business License and verify via China’s National Enterprise Credit Information Publicity System (NECIPS). |
| 1.3 | Verify Factory Address & Ownership | Ensure the supplier owns or operates a real manufacturing facility. | Use Google Earth, Baidu Maps, and request a video tour of the facility. |
| 1.4 | Conduct On-Site or Remote Audit | Assess production capability, quality control, and working conditions. | Use third-party inspection services (e.g., SGS, Intertek) or SourcifyChina’s audit protocol. |
| 1.5 | Request Product Certifications | Confirm compliance with international standards. | Verify presence of CE, RoHS, FCC, CARB, and ISO 9001 certifications. Request test reports. |
| 1.6 | Evaluate R&D and Customization Capability | Determine if the manufacturer can support OEM/ODM projects. | Request product development timelines, engineering team size, and past ODM case studies. |
| 1.7 | Sample Testing & QA Process Review | Validate product performance and consistency. | Order 3–5 production samples; conduct independent lab testing (e.g., CADR, noise, filter efficiency). |
| 1.8 | Check Export History & Client References | Assess reliability and market reputation. | Request 2–3 verifiable client references (preferably in your region) and request shipping records (e.g., bill of lading samples). |
2. How to Distinguish Between a Trading Company and a Factory
| Indicator | Trading Company | Actual Factory |
|---|---|---|
| Business License Scope | Lists “import/export,” “trading,” or “sales” as primary activities. | Includes “manufacturing,” “production,” or specific product codes (e.g., 3842 for air purifiers). |
| Facility Size & Equipment | No production machinery visible; office-only setup. | Visible production lines, injection molding machines, assembly stations, and QC labs. |
| Pricing Structure | Higher quoted prices with limited cost breakdown. | Transparent BOM (Bill of Materials) and component sourcing details. |
| Lead Times | Longer or inconsistent lead times due to third-party coordination. | Shorter, consistent lead times with direct process control. |
| Customization Ability | Limited to minor design changes; reliant on factory partners. | Full control over molds, PCBs, firmware, and packaging. |
| Staff Expertise | Sales-focused team; limited technical depth. | On-site engineers, R&D team, and QC managers. |
| Factory Audit Results | May refuse audits or delay access. | Welcomes audits; provides real-time production data. |
Pro Tip: Use 企查查 (Qichacha) or 天眼查 (Tianyancha) to check company equity structure. Factories often have direct links to machinery purchases, patents, and manufacturing subsidiaries.
3. Red Flags to Avoid When Sourcing Air Purifier Manufacturers
| Red Flag | Risk | Recommended Action |
|---|---|---|
| Unwillingness to provide factory address or video tour | Likely a trading company or non-existent facility. | Disqualify until physical verification is completed. |
| No product certifications or fake documentation | Risk of non-compliance, customs rejection, and brand liability. | Demand original certificates; verify via certification bodies. |
| Extremely low pricing compared to market average | Indicates substandard materials, labor violations, or scam. | Conduct material cost analysis; audit supply chain. |
| Pressure for large upfront payments (e.g., 100% TT) | High fraud risk. | Use secure payment terms: 30% deposit, 70% against BL copy. |
| Inconsistent communication or vague technical answers | Suggests lack of engineering control. | Require direct contact with technical team. |
| No experience with your target market (e.g., EU, USA) | Risk of non-compliant products. | Confirm prior exports to your region with documentation. |
| Refusal to sign NDA or IP agreement | Risk of design theft. | Require IP protection clauses in contract. |
4. Best Practices for Risk Mitigation
- Use Escrow or Letter of Credit (LC): For first-time orders, avoid wire transfers without assurance.
- Implement a QC Protocol: Define AQL 2.5/4.0 standards and conduct pre-shipment inspections.
- Secure Tooling Ownership: Ensure molds and custom components are legally assigned to your company.
- Monitor Supply Chain Resilience: Verify dual sourcing for critical components (e.g., HEPA filters, sensors).
- Leverage Third-Party Verification: Partner with sourcing consultants or inspection agencies for ongoing oversight.
